Abstract :
The ditopic aminodiphosphines CH2(4,4′-Ph2PNHC6H4)2 (2) and CH2(4,4′-Ph2PCH2NHC6H4)2 (5) are obtained by reaction of 4,4′-diaminodiphenylmethane with ClPPh2 and (i) (CH2O)n/NaOMe/(ii) HPPh2, respectively. Treatment of (η4-nbd)Mo(CO)4 with 2 and 5 under high-dilution conditions in CH2Cl2 affords the tetraazatetraphosphadimolybdaclophanes [CH2(4,4′-(OC)4Mo(Ph2PNHC6H4)2)]2 (3) and [CH2(4,4′-(OC)4Mo(Ph2PCH2NHC6H4)2)]2 (6) in relatively high yields. The structures of 3 and 6 were investigated by X-ray crystal-structure analyses. Whereas the cavity of the molecular structure of 3 can be described by a parallelogram, that of 6 has the shape of a boat in which the diphenylmethane building blocks form the hull and the cis-(Ph2P)2Mo(CO)4 fragments represent the bow and stem, respectively. Because of the formation of only very weak hydrogen bonds in 3 and 6, no binding to molecules like p-benzoquinone, 1,4-cyclohexanedione, 2,5-piperazinedione and trans-1,4-diaminocyclohexane could be detected.
